Подтвердить что ты не робот

Как удалить событие $.hover, добавленное jQuery?

Я пробовал $.unbind('hover'), который не работает.

4b9b3361

Ответ 1

hover функционирует как просто короткая рука для привязки двух обработчиков к mouseenter и mouseleave, вы должны отпереть их:

$('#item').unbind('mouseenter mouseleave');

Ответ 2

Документация Api на hover:

Пример. Чтобы отвязать приведенный выше пример, используйте:

$("td").off('mouseenter mouseleave');

Ответ 3

разворот с помощью щелчка

$('.item').click(function() { 
 $('.item').unbind('mouseenter mouseleave');
});

Ответ 4

Вы также можете попробовать:

$('#item').bind('hover', function(){return false})